Description
Freddie whirls around to and fro, buzzing from one distraction to another. His lack of concentration causes a real fright when he finds himself lost and alone at the zoo. Will that be the scare Fredde needs to finally take action and turn his BEE on and his BUZZ off.--Publisher.
